1.2. The Brink’s Company: A Brief Overview
The Brink’s Company, a global leader in security and protection services, has embraced AI as a core component of its strategy. Operating in over 100 countries, Brink’s provides secure transportation, cash management, and other security services to a wide range of industries, including financial institutions, retailers, and government entities.
